How to fill out return of organization exempt

How to fill out return of organization exempt:
01
Gather all necessary information and documents related to the organization's exempt status, such as the organization's tax identification number, financial records, and details about its activities and programs.
02
Begin by downloading Form 990, also known as the Return of Organization Exempt from Income Tax, from the official website of the Internal Revenue Service (IRS).
03
Make sure to carefully read the instructions provided with the form to understand the requirements and ensure accurate completion.
04
Start filling out the basic information section of the form, including the organization's name, address, and contact details.
05
Provide details about the organization's exempt status, such as its classification under Section 501(c) of the Internal Revenue Code and the applicable subsection.
06
Report the organization's mission and purpose, and describe its activities and accomplishments during the tax year.
07
Complete the financial information section of the form, including revenue, expenses, assets, and liabilities.
08
Ensure accurate reporting of any grants, contributions, or scholarships provided by the organization.
09
Provide detailed information about the compensation of key individuals within the organization, including officers, directors, and highly compensated employees.
10
If required, attach additional schedules or forms as instructed to provide further details or explanations.
11
Review the completed form thoroughly for any errors or omissions before submitting it to the IRS.
12
Keep a copy of the completed form for the organization's records.
Who needs return of organization exempt:
01
Nonprofit organizations recognized as tax-exempt under Section 501(c) of the Internal Revenue Code are generally required to file Form 990.
02
This includes charitable, educational, religious, scientific, literary, and other organizations that meet the specified criteria for exemption.
03
The filing requirement can vary depending on the organization's annual gross receipts and its status as a public charity or private foundation.
04
It is essential for these tax-exempt organizations to accurately complete and file the return of organization exempt to maintain their tax-exempt status and fulfill their reporting obligations to the IRS.

What is return of organization exempt?
The return of organization exempt is a form filed by tax-exempt organizations to provide information on their finances and activities.
Who is required to file return of organization exempt?
Tax-exempt organizations such as charities, churches, and other nonprofits are required to file a return of organization exempt.
How to fill out return of organization exempt?
The return of organization exempt can be filled out online or by mail using Form 990 or Form 990-EZ, depending on the size of the organization.
What is the purpose of return of organization exempt?
The purpose of the return of organization exempt is to provide transparency and accountability for tax-exempt organizations and ensure they are operating within the guidelines of their tax-exempt status.
What information must be reported on return of organization exempt?
The return of organization exempt requires information on the organization's finances, activities, governance, and compliance with tax laws.
